Ace Frehley's "Budokan" Les Paul Custom Sells for $512,000

A 1975 Cherry Sunburst Gibson Les Paul Custom, famously played by Ace Frehley during Kiss's performances at Japan's Nippon Budokan arena, has been sold at auction for $512,000. This guitar was a primary instrument for the late Kiss guitarist throughout the late 1970s and featured prominently on the album "Love Gun." Originally reported by MusicRadar.
